    I'm in Verona and SlowLeak is just up the road from me with his near completed Coyote roadster. He was nice enough to show it to me and even take me for a quick spin. I am only 5'7" so there was plenty of leg room, but I do understand why some builders obsess over space for your feet. I occasionally fat-foot while shifting or braking in my donor Mustang and expect it will be at least that bad in the roadster. I can also imagine the passenger (my wife) wanting more space for her feet. Neither of these is worry enough to discourage me and once I finally have the kit in my garage, I can decide whether to just live with it or slightly enlarge the footboxes since my engine will be relatively small (302).     By all means, expand the passenger foot box! It's not particularly expensive (~$200 in material at https://www.onlinemetals.com/merchan...76&top_cat=60; use 0.090 for floor if you're not satisfied with solidity of driver side), not particularly difficult (use cardboard to get the size & shape of panels right), and if you screw up easy enough to replace the bad panel. Take a look at Post #179 of my build log (https://www.ffcars.com/forums/17-fac...-build-10.html) to see what's involved.
